构建一个高效企业信息系统的高质量数据管理平台是一个复杂而关键的任务,它需要综合考虑技术、业务需求、安全性和可扩展性等多个方面。以下是构建高质量数据管理平台的一些关键步骤和考虑因素:
1. 明确目标与需求:在开始之前,必须确定企业信息系统的目标和需求。这包括了解企业的业务流程、数据类型、数据量、访问频率以及预期的业务成果。
2. 选择合适的技术栈:根据企业的规模、业务需求和技术能力选择合适的技术栈。常见的技术包括关系数据库管理系统(如mysql, postgresql)、nosql数据库(如mongodb, cassandra)、大数据处理框架(如hadoop, spark)以及云服务(如aws, azure)。
3. 设计数据模型:设计合理的数据模型是确保数据质量和系统性能的关键。这通常涉及到实体-关系模型(er模型)的设计,以及如何存储和管理数据。
4. 数据治理:建立数据治理策略,包括数据质量标准、数据安全政策、数据备份和恢复计划等。确保数据的一致性、准确性和完整性。
5. 数据集成:整合来自不同来源的数据,并确保数据的一致性和准确性。使用etl工具或apis来自动化这一过程。
6. 数据存储:选择合适的存储解决方案,如分布式文件系统(如hdfs, gfs),对象存储(如amazon s3, google cloud storage)或关系型数据库。
7. 数据安全与隐私:实施强有力的数据安全措施,包括加密、访问控制、身份验证和监控。遵守相关的数据保护法规,如gdpr或hipaa。
8. 性能优化:确保数据管理平台能够处理大量数据,并且响应迅速。使用缓存、索引、查询优化等技术来提高性能。
9. 灾难恢复计划:制定灾难恢复计划,以应对可能的数据丢失或系统故障。这包括定期备份数据、设置冗余系统和测试恢复流程。
10. 持续监控与维护:实施实时监控系统来跟踪数据管理平台的运行状况,及时发现并解决问题。定期进行维护和升级,以确保系统的长期稳定运行。
11. 用户培训与支持:为用户提供必要的培训和支持,帮助他们有效使用数据管理平台。确保用户能够理解数据的重要性,并知道如何正确地操作数据。
12. 合规性与标准化:确保数据管理平台符合行业标准和法规要求,如iso/iec 27001信息安全管理体系等。
通过上述步骤,可以构建一个既高效又可靠的数据管理平台,为企业的决策提供坚实的数据支持,同时保护企业免受数据泄露和其他安全威胁的影响。